试验
How to Understand
试验 means 'test' or 'experiment' in English. It refers to a procedure or activity designed to evaluate the effectiveness, validity, or functionality of something. Unlike 'trial,' which can also mean a test, 试验 often implies a more structured or scientific approach.
The character 试 (shì) originally meant 'to try' or 'to test,' and 验 (yàn) means 'to verify' or 'to examine.' Together, they form a compound that emphasizes the process of testing or verifying something through practical application.
试验 is commonly used in scientific, technical, and academic contexts. For example, medical research often involves 试验 to determine the safety and efficacy of new drugs. In everyday language, it might refer to trying out a new idea or method before fully committing to it.
